ZIP Code 13744 is a 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Broome County, New York, home to about 1,284 residents. Its median household income of $63,125 runs in line with the Broome County figure of $61,059.
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 13744's population grew 12.4% from 1,142 to 1,284, while its median gross rent rose 41.3% from $640 to $904.
65.5% of homes are single-family detached houses. The typical home was built around 1974.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 1,142 | $62,778 | $117,600 | $640 |
| 2020 | 1,307 | $63,333 | $105,600 | $630 |
| 2021 | 1,393 | $66,985 | $97,900 | $820 |
| 2022 | 1,359 | $61,250 | $112,200 | $833 |
| 2023 | 1,284 | $63,125 | $119,200 | $904 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
